Atomic absorption and fluorescence spectrometry with a carbon filament atom reservoir: Part XIII The determination of chromium with a fully enclosed atom reservoir
Authors:KW Jackson  TS West  L Balchin
Institution:Chemistry Department, Imperial College of Science and Technology, London SW7 2AY England;Organics and Pigments Division, Laporte Industries Ltd., Grimsby, LincolnEngland
Abstract:The detection and measurement of chromium by atomic absorption spectrometry with a carbon filament atom reservoir is described. At a wavelength of 357.9 nm, a sensitivity (1% absorption) of 9.2·10-12 g was obtained. The detection limit was 1·1O-11 g; in terms of concentration this is similar to that normally detectable in a flame. Results are presented for the effects of a number of interfering species.
